Denver Biker Club Shooting Leaves 2 Dead, 5 Injured; No Arrests Made Yet in Ongoing Investigation
Shooting at Hell's Lovers Motorcycle Club Following Confrontation with Multiple Guns Involved; Victims Include One Woman and All are Adults.
- The shooting occurred at a private, after-hours motorcycle club in Denver around 3am on Sunday, resulting in two men being killed and five other people being injured.
- At least two guns were fired during the confrontation, with police considering the possibility that victims may have also discharged a gun.
- A woman is among the injured, and all victims were adults. Two of the injured have since been released from the hospital, while the others are expected to survive.
- A local reported waking up to approximately 20 gunshots, originally mistaking them for fireworks, followed by screaming and people fleeing the scene in vehicles.
- As of Monday, no arrests have been made. However, five men were seen being led out of the club by SWAT officers, with three being handcuffed.
